Keep Flammable Materials Away from Heat Sources🔥
Many fires start because combustible materials are placed too close to sources of heat. Paper, cardboard, curtains, clothing, cleaning chemicals, gasoline, paint thinners, aerosol cans and LPG cylinders can ignite or contribute to the rapid spread of fire when exposed to high temperatures, open flames or sparks.
To reduce the risk of fire:
✅ Store flammable liquids and chemicals in a cool, well-ventilated area.
✅ Keep paper, cardboard, fabric and other combustible materials away from stoves, heaters, electrical equipment and open flames.
✅ Never place aerosol cans or fuel containers near direct sunlight or heat sources.
✅ Maintain a safe clearance around cooking appliances, generators and other heat-producing equipment.
✅ Keep a fire extinguisher readily accessible and know how to use it 💭
⚠️A small spark can become a major fire if flammable materials are not stored properly.
